It's not a popular sentiment when you lose 10 straight SEC games, or whatever it was.

In a normal recruiting rotation, 4 or 5 of these players as a whole would be a great addition to 4 or 5 veteran holdovers.

We didn't have near that to start the year, and our best veteran player, Beverly gets suspended.

I like the group of fresh faces we saw this year.

Fortson, we've all seen it, how good he was against top 10 teams, we all know how good he can be.

Henry, in the brief spots he finds his game, he looks awesome, seems to have an clear athletic advantage over his defender, very quick. He ran some point late in the game today and looked just natural and quick handling and distributing the ball, until this I had only considered his post moves and 3 pt shooting. Henry seems to have a lot of upside.

What Sanchez has shown me is that he defintely has the tools. at times catching and shooting with confidence, great form, good moves around the basket, good size and not afraid to bang. He just struggled consistantly finding his game, but the game is there, at least from what I see.

Clarke faced true freshman conditioning issues I think. He may never be a defensive stopper but I think he'll learn to stop being a defensive liability late in games. Even if he is only a 15- 20 minute a game type guy in the future he can still be a
game changer with the way he can score. I don't think any of our new players suffered more from our overall lack of depth than Rotnie Clarke. When we are deeper and stronger at guard next year, RC will really be able to blossom I think.

Those 4 players have been great additons, along with a few may who may be able to break out in the coming weeks. The problem is what they were "added" to, the only real veterans being Washington and Welsh.

My point being if we can add 4 more next year this good, then 4 more the year following that, we will be OK.
